  • Yamanba, which may be roughly understood as 'mountain hag', are a type of youkai that inhabit the mountains as their name states. They're often depicted as malicious beings that kill people and children lost in the mountains, but there are some folklore stories which depict them as motherly figures towards children abandoned in the mountains, which would grow up to be a hero.
